This photo was taken on Tuesday morning when Ross Ingram was one of several senior citizens to be presented with "2016 seniors recognition awards" His citation mentioned his service in the community, Rotary, and pre and post the 2013 fires. A most worthy recipient. Congratulations, Ross.
